Woman Dies While Aborting 2-Month-Old Pregnancy Using ARVs And PEP

By AFAYO SHADRACH BETHEL
Police in Amuru district has arrested a woman for allegedly procuring an unsafe abortion using a combination of antiretroviral drugs (ARVs) with post-exposure prophylaxis (PEP) and some local herbs leading to the death of a 22-year-old friend Concy Aryemo.
According to police, the suspect identified as Proscovia Ayerwot, a resident of Kal B Cell in Pabbo town council, Amuru district lured Aryemo to ingest local herbs and drugs to terminate her two-months-old pregnancy.
A statement from Jimmy Opiro, a relative of the deceased, indicates that Ayerwot gave Aryemo the drugs and convinced her to ingest them last Tuesday with hopes of terminating the pregnancy.
However, Aryemo developed complications after taking the concoctions prompting relatives to rush her to Pabbo health centre III for medical attention.
Her condition worsened and she was later transferred to St Mary’s Hospital Lacor in Gulu City for further management from where she died a day later.
Opiro says upon interrogation before her death, Aryemo confessed that she took the concoctions which were given to her by Ayerwot to terminate the pregnancy.
